What batteries are used to store energy in the polar regions
A sand battery is an energy storage system that uses sand. The mechanism is relatively simple: it uses excess electricity from solar or wind power to heat the sand to high temperatures through electrical resistance. Currently, most EV charging in the United States is level two (L2), typically between 7 kW and 19 kW, with charging units often installed in a private garage or at the workplace.
